Ingredients for One-Pot Chicken and Mushroom Gravy Rice
Gathering the right ingredients is the first step to creating this delightful One-Pot Chicken and Mushroom Gravy Rice. Here’s what you’ll need:
- Chicken thighs: Boneless and skinless, they’re juicy and flavorful, perfect for this dish.
- Mushrooms: Sliced, they add an earthy depth to the gravy. I love using cremini or button mushrooms.
- Rice: Long-grain rice works best, as it cooks evenly and absorbs the savory flavors beautifully.
- Chicken broth: This is the heart of the gravy. Use low-sodium broth for better control over saltiness.
- Onion: Chopped, it adds sweetness and aroma, creating a lovely base for the dish.
- Garlic: Minced, it brings a punch of flavor that elevates the entire meal.
- Olive oil: For sautéing, it adds richness and helps to brown the chicken and veggies.
- Thyme: A teaspoon of dried thyme infuses the dish with a warm, herbal note.
- Salt and pepper: Essential for seasoning, adjust to your taste for the perfect balance.
For those looking to enhance the flavor even more, consider adding a splash of soy sauce or Worcestershire sauce. You can also sneak in some veggies like peas or carrots for added nutrition. If you’re in a pinch, feel free to substitute chicken with turkey or even tofu for a vegetarian twist.

How to Make One-Pot Chicken and Mushroom Gravy Rice
Now that we have our ingredients ready, let’s get cooking! This One-Pot Chicken and Mushroom Gravy Rice is straightforward and fun to make.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a delicious meal in no time!
Step 1: Heat the Olive Oil
Start by heating the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. This step is crucial because it helps to create a nice base for your dish. When the oil is hot, it will ensure that the chicken and veggies brown beautifully, locking in all those delicious flavors.
Step 2: Sauté the Onion and Garlic
Next, add the chopped onion and minced garlic to the pot. Sauté them until the onion turns translucent, about 3-4 minutes. This step is where the magic begins! The aroma of sautéing onion and garlic fills your kitchen, setting the stage for a comforting meal.
Step 3: Brown the Chicken Thighs
Now it’s time to add the chicken thighs. Cook them until they’re browned on all sides, which should take about 5-7 minutes. Browning the chicken is essential because it adds depth and richness to the dish. Plus, who doesn’t love that golden color?
Step 4: Add the Mushrooms
Once the chicken is browned, stir in the sliced mushrooms. Cook them for another 3-4 minutes until they soften. Mushrooms not only enhance the flavor but also add a lovely texture to the gravy. They soak up all the savory goodness, making every bite delightful.
Step 5: Combine Rice and Broth
Now, it’s time to add the rice and chicken broth. Pour in the long-grain rice, followed by the broth, thyme, salt, and pepper. Give it a good stir to combine everything.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low and cover the pot. This is where the magic happens!
Step 6: Simmer and Cook
Let the dish simmer for 20-25 minutes. Keep the pot covered to trap the steam, which helps the rice cook perfectly. Check for doneness by tasting the rice. It should be tender and fluffy, with all the liquid absorbed. If it’s not quite there, give it a few more minutes.
Step 7: Fluff and Serve
Once the rice is cooked, fluff it gently with a fork. This step is key to keeping the rice light and airy. Serve your One-Pot Chicken and Mushroom Gravy Rice hot, and watch your family dig in with smiles. For a lovely presentation, sprinkle some fresh herbs on top or serve it with a side salad!

FAQs about One-Pot Chicken and Mushroom Gravy Rice
Can I use brown rice instead of white rice?
Absolutely! Just keep in mind that brown rice takes longer to cook. You’ll need to adjust the cooking time to about 40-45 minutes. Make sure to add extra broth to ensure it cooks through.
Can I make this dish ahead of time?
Yes! This One-Pot Chicken and Mushroom Gravy Rice is perfect for meal prep. You can cook it ahead and store it in the fridge for up to three days. Just reheat it gently on the stove or in the microwave.
What can I substitute for chicken thighs?
If you prefer, you can use chicken breasts or even turkey. For a vegetarian option, chickpeas or tofu work wonderfully. Just adjust the cooking time accordingly to ensure everything is cooked through.
How can I make this dish spicier?
For a spicy kick, add red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ce while cooking. You can also toss in some diced jalapeños for an extra layer of heat!
What sides pair well with this dish?
This One-Pot Chicken and Mushroom Gravy Rice is hearty enough on its own, but it pairs beautifully with a crisp green salad or some steamed vegetables. A slice of crusty bread is also a great addition to soak up the gravy!

One-Pot Chicken and Mushroom Gravy Rice: Easy Dinner Delight!
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Gluten Free
Description
A simple and delicious one-pot meal featuring chicken, mushrooms, and rice cooked in a savory gravy.
Ingredients
- 1 lb chicken thighs, boneless and skinless
- 1 cup mushrooms, sliced
- 1 cup rice, long-grain
- 2 cups chicken broth
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on thyme
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.
- Add chopped onion and minced garlic, sauté until translucent.
- Add chicken thighs and cook until browned on all sides.
- Stir in sliced mushrooms and cook for another 3-4 minutes.
- Add rice, chicken broth, thyme, salt, and pepper.
-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low and cover.
- Cook for 20-25 minutes or until rice is tender and liquid is absorbed.
- Fluff with a fork and serve hot.
Notes
- For extra flavor, add a splash of soy sauce or Worcestershire sauce.
- Feel free to add vegetables like peas or carrots for added nutrition.
- This dish can be made ahead and reheated for quick meals.
